Karen representatives selected for Union-level CSO forum

Ten representatives have been vetted and approved to represent Kayin (Karen) State civil society organizations at an upcoming Union-level peace conference.

The representatives – one for each of the state’s seven townships as well a three reserves – were chosen during an April 4-5 meeting in Hpa-an, according to one of the organizers, Saw Zaw Lin.

The representatives will participate in the Union-level CSO forum to be held in conjunction with the next Union Peace Conference, tentatively scheduled for May.

“The [Kayin State] representatives selected from each township were chosen because they can best represent his or her township,” said Naw Ta Kaw Htoo, one of the selected representatives, and a member of 88 Generation Peace and Open Society in Kawkareik township.
